After early releases like “Lights,” “AfterParty,” and “Pretty Girls” surpassed 2M streams, Omar+’s profile exploded through collaborations with Josh Baker, Luke Dean, bullet tooth, and Obskür. With BBC Radio 1 support, festival debuts at Reading & Leeds, sell-out headline shows, a Rinse FM residency, and cosigns from names like Peggy Gou, Chris Stussy, Danny Howard, and MK, Omar+ has quickly become one of dance music’s most exciting breakout names.
